Automation in Transportation Security

Automated Monitoring Systems: Utilizing automated surveillance systems equipped with AI capabilities enables real-time monitoring of transport vehicles and facilities. These systems can detect anomalies and alert security personnel to potential threats, ensuring a rapid response to incidents.

Robotic Process Automation (RPA): RPA can automate routine tasks such as documentation, compliance checks, and reporting. By minimizing manual intervention, organizations reduce the risk of errors and enhance compliance with security regulations.

Data Analytics for Enhanced Decision-Making

Data analytics is revolutionizing how organizations approach transportation security. By harnessing vast amounts of data, businesses can make informed decisions and proactively address potential risks.

Predictive Analytics: Leveraging predictive analytics allows organizations to anticipate security threats before they occur. By analyzing historical data and identifying patterns, companies can develop strategies to mitigate risks and enhance their security posture.

Real-Time Data Processing: Collecting and analyzing real-time data from various sources, such as GPS tracking and IoT devices, provides organizations with immediate insights into their operations. This visibility enables quick responses to security incidents and enhances overall operational efficiency.

Blockchain Technology for Transparency and Trust

Blockchain technology is emerging as a game-changer in the secure transportation sector. Its decentralized and immutable nature offers several advantages for enhancing security.

Supply Chain Transparency: By using blockchain to track the movement of goods, organizations can create a transparent and tamper-proof record of each transaction. This visibility helps prevent fraud and ensures that all parties in the supply chain can verify the authenticity of products.

Smart Contracts: Implementing smart contracts can automate agreements between stakeholders, ensuring that conditions are met before transactions are executed. This reduces the potential for disputes and enhances trust among partners in the supply chain.

Advanced Security Systems

Innovations in security technology are providing organizations with powerful tools to protect their assets during transportation. These advancements are essential for addressing the evolving threat landscape.

Biometric Authentication: Biometric security measures, such as fingerprint and facial recognition, are becoming increasingly popular in transportation security. These systems ensure that only authorized personnel can access sensitive areas or handle valuable cargo.

The Role of Drones and Autonomous Vehicles

Drones and autonomous vehicles are emerging as significant innovations in secure transportation, offering unique solutions to various logistical challenges.

Drones for Surveillance and Delivery: Drones equipped with cameras can provide aerial surveillance of transportation routes, enhancing security by monitoring for potential threats. Additionally, they can streamline delivery processes, reducing reliance on traditional transportation methods.

Autonomous Vehicles: The development of autonomous vehicles is set to revolutionize the transportation industry. These vehicles can be equipped with advanced security features, such as real-time monitoring and automated incident reporting, reducing the potential for human error and enhancing safety.
